序言
记录学习Linux的一些命令
开启端口
iptables
iptables -I INPUT -p tcp --dport 55555 -j ACCEPT
iptables-save
iptables -L
firewall
firewall-cmd --zone=public --add-port=8888/tcp --permanent
firewall-cmd --reload # 配置立即生效
firewall-cmd --zone=public --list-ports 查看开放的端口
systemctl start firewalld.service 开启
systemctl enable firewalld.service 开机重启
文件查找
grep -r "accessKey" /home/
grep -r "jdbc:mysql" /home/
find / -name httpd.conf
find / -name php.ini
find / -name favicon.ico
find / -name application.yml
find / -name application-prod.yml
whereis gcc
docker学习
docker ps -a 查看所有的docker
docker inspect ARL | grep Mounts -A 20 查看挂载的容器的 目录地址
systemctl restart docker
docker run -it -d --name ARL -p 5003:5003 tophant/arl:latest
默认docker 路劲 /var/lib/docker/overlay2/
docker stop $(docker ps -a | awk '{ print $1}' | tail -n +2) 停止所有容器
docker start $(docker ps -a | awk '{ print $1}' | tail -n +2) 启动所有容器
docker rmi $(docker images | awk '{print $3}' |tail -n +2) 删除所有容器镜像
docker rm $(docker ps -a | awk '{ print $1}' | tail -n +2) 删除所有容器
本文作者为彦祖,转载请注明。